Taco Slaw
Prep Time 20 mins
Cook Time 15 mins
Total Time 35 mins
Course Entree
Cuisine Mexican
Servings 4 Servings
Calories 273 kcal
- 1 pound 93/7 ground turkey
- 1 bag cold slaw mix
- 4 TBSP taco seasoning
- 1 can diced tomatoes with green chilies
Heat a large skillet over medium heat.
Put the ground beef and 2 tablespoons of the seasoning blend in the pan and cook until the meat is browned and cooked through, about 15 minutes.
To the skillet, add the diced tomatoes and green chilies, coleslaw mix, and remaining 2 tablespoons of the seasoning blend. Cook until the cabbage is tender, about 7 minutes.
Taste and add salt, if desired.
Garnishments: Top each serving with avocado slices, green onions, as well as cilantro, jalapeños, black olives or sour cream, if using.

Turkey Meatballs
Prep Time 10 mins
Cook Time 30 mins
Total Time 40 mins
Servings 16 meatballs
Calories 135 kcal
Meatballs
- 2 pounds 93/7 ground turkey
- 1 small onion, chopped
- 2 packages dry onion soup mix
- 1/2 cup egg whites
Sauce
- 2 TBSP butter
- 2 TBSP flour
- 1 cup beef broth
- 1/4 tsp garlic powder
- 1/4 tsp onion powder
- 1 1/2 TBSP Worcestershire sauce
- 1/2 cup 2% milk
- 1/2 tsp dried oregano
- salt and pepper to taste
Meatballs
Heat Skillet to Medium Heat
In large bowl mix ground turkey, onion, onion soup mix, and egg whites. Shape into 1 1/2-2 inch meatballs. Heat over medium heat in large non-stick skillet. Add meatballs and cook until browned on all sides. Do not crowd the skillet. If necessary work in batches.
Once meatballs are cooked, add in 1 large can of cream of mushroom soup.
Sauce
Melt butter in same skillet over medium low heat. Whisk in flour and cook for 2-3 minutes; whisking constantly. Whisk in beef broth, garlic powder, onion powder, Worcestershire sauce, cream and oregano in large skillet. Simmer for 15 minutes. Add meatballs to skillet and spoon sauce over meatballs. Sprinkle with fresh parsley.
Serve over cauliflower rice or rice.
Four ways to keep your meatballs round!
- Refrigerate – after rolling the meatballs store covered in the refrigerator for at least one hour or up to 24 hours.
- Freeze – Place the meatballs on a cookie covered with parchment paper. They can be close together but not touching. Place them in the freezer until frozen. You can cook from frozen or transfer to freezer bags. They are good for up to three months.
- Bake – Place on a cookie sheet and bake at 375 degrees for about 20 minutes or until cooked through. This method works fairly well because the meatballs are not turned like on the stove top.
- Simmer in liquid – drop into simmering broth until they are partially cooked. When they float remove them to paper towels and then brown in a skillet or in the oven.

Egg Roll in a Bowl
Prep Time 10 mins
Cook Time 10 mins
Total Time 20 mins
Servings 8 cups
Calories 122 kcal
- 1 pound 93/7 ground turkey
- 7 cups coleslaw mix
- 2 TBSP liquid aminos
- 1 TBSP garlic powder
- 1/2 cup green onion
Cook turkey.
Stir in coleslaw mix, garlic, aminos and stir.
Top with green onions and drizzle with more aminos.
This is also served great together with cauliflower rice.
